WILLIAM C. COLEMAN, District Judge.

This is a suit under the Miller Act § 1, 40 U.S.C.A. § 270a, brought by the manufacturer and supplier of the material, Baltimore Brick Company, against the subcontractor, J. Friedman Company, and the general contractor's surety, in connection with work on a government project involving the construction of certain dormitories and other buildings at Jarboesville, St. Mary's County, Maryland.
